What Cat Grooming Insurance Benefits Cover: The Basics

Cat Grooming Insurance Benefits typically cover veterinary costs related to grooming injuries, skin conditions, and emergency procedures like mat removal. While routine grooming (such as brushing or nail trims) is usually not included, many policies will pay for treatment if your cat develops a skin infection, hot spot, or needs sedation for severe matting. According to Dr. Lisa Jones, DVM, 'Grooming-related injuries are more common than most owners realize, especially in long-haired breeds.' Coverage varies by provider. Lemonade and Healthy Paws both include accidental injuries from grooming, while Trupanion is known for covering hereditary skin conditions that may require ongoing care. ASPCA offers wellness add-ons that can help with preventive care, but routine grooming is still excluded. Always check the policy details for breed-specific exclusions and state regulations, as some states require broader coverage than others. Real claim data shows that the average payout for grooming-related vet visits ranges from $180 to $650, depending on the severity and location. For example, a Maine Coon in California may have higher costs than a Siamese in Texas due to regional price differences. Cat Grooming Insurance Benefits Cost Analysis: Real Data & State Comparison

The cost of Cat Grooming Insurance Benefits depends on your cat’s age, breed, location, and the provider you choose. Monthly premiums typically range from $15 for basic coverage to $70 for comprehensive plans with low deductibles. For example, Lemonade offers plans starting at $15 per month for young, healthy cats, while Trupanion’s rates can reach $70 for older or high-risk breeds. Deductibles also play a big role. Most providers let you choose between $100 and $1,000 deductibles, with lower deductibles resulting in higher monthly costs. Reimbursement rates range from 70% to 90%, and annual limits can be as low as $5,000 or unlimited, depending on the plan. State-by-state data shows that cat insurance is most expensive in California, New York, and Florida, with average monthly premiums 20-30% higher than the national average. In contrast, states like Ohio and Texas offer lower rates. For a detailed breakdown, see our average pet insurance cost by state article. Breed-specific pricing is another factor. Persians, Maine Coons, and Ragdolls often cost more to insure due to their grooming needs. For example, a 3-year-old Maine Coon in New York may cost $45 per month to insure, while a 5-year-old Siamese in Texas could be as low as $22. Always compare quotes for your cat’s breed and age before enrolling.

How Cat Grooming Insurance Claims Work: Step-by-Step Guide

Filing a claim for Cat Grooming Insurance Benefits is usually straightforward, but the process can vary by provider. Most companies require you to pay the vet bill upfront, then submit a claim online or through a mobile app. Lemonade’s AI-powered system can approve claims in minutes, while ASPCA and Trupanion may take several days to process. To file a claim, you’ll need your vet’s invoice, a detailed description of the incident, and sometimes medical records. Some providers, like Trupanion, offer direct payment to your vet, so you don’t have to wait for reimbursement. Healthy Paws is known for fast processing, with most claims paid within two days. Be aware of waiting periods, which can range from 2 to 30 days depending on the type of claim. Pre-existing conditions are usually excluded, and some providers have breed-specific exclusions for grooming-related issues.
